Around about 09/02/05 13:25, Pete Stagman typed ...
Do you have the script set to send the receiver PowerButton? Most
power events are a toggle, if the power is on - turn it off, if it's
off - turn it on. That can play havoc with mythtv if everytime you
change a channel it sends a power signal.

Wayne Steenburg writes:
Hi Neil,
Yes the PVR-350 will allow you to view recorded shows via it's tv-out
port. If it's mpeg-2 encoded content it will also decode it on the card
lightening your cpu load. Otherwise X will just utilize the framebuffer
and the cpu will perform the process
